Opportunities for Indian Companies in the CIS Logistics Market

TransRussia©24

01

Trade Corridors Shifting East

As Eurasia pivots supply routes through the Middle Corridor and North–South Corridor, demand is growing for agile, cost-efficient logistics partners, a space Indian firms can fill with multimodal expertise and flexible pricing.

TransRussia©24

02

Equipment & Tech Demand Rising

CIS logistics operators are modernising fleets, warehouses, and tracking systems. Indian suppliers of fleet management tech, telematics, cold-chain, and handling equipment are in strong demand.

TransRussia©24

03

Warehousing & 3PL Partnerships

Russia and neighbouring CIS countries are investing heavily in logistics parks and bonded warehouses. Indian 3PLs and integrators can establish partnerships or local JVs to serve regional distribution needs.

TransRussia©24

04

Port & Maritime Synergies

With growing cargo flows via the Caspian and Black Sea, Indian port operators, shipping lines, and freight forwarders can expand service networks and offer multimodal links via Iran and Central Asia.

TransRussia©24

05

Engineering & Infrastructure Expertise

CIS markets are seeking partners for infrastructure build-out, rail terminals, automation systems, and warehouse construction. Indian EPC and logistics-tech firms can capture these projects.

TransRussia©24

06

Neutral Trade Advantage

Amid geopolitical realignments, India’s balanced trade stance allows its companies to operate freely with Russia, Kazakhstan, and Belarus, opening routes closed to Western players.
